Gap funding

GranteeFY26 allocationsLive posture
State Of Arkansas (state) CDBG $17.6M · HOME $9.1M HOME undrawn $43.5M

Allocations are FY2026 HUD formula amounts (annual scale, not balances). "Undrawn" = obligated-not-yet-drawn on FY2020+ formula grants (USASpending, monthly), which may be committed to projects. Timeliness is a proxy for HUD's 24 CFR 570.902 standard (1.5× line); program income is not visible in public data.
